Varieties

Description of the design of a stationary blender
The device for sale is of two types: stationary, submersible. Which blender is better to buy? Consider both options in more detail, highlighting all their advantages and disadvantages.

Stationary 

This view is a plastic or metal stand with an electric motor, on which the tank is installed, and there is a cutting of products. The motor is located in the stand, and the control panel is located on top.

For this unit to work, you need to load the tank, install it on a stand, select the desired program (if there are settings) and turn it on. It is more rational to use such a stationary device when sauces, mashed potatoes, etc. are prepared with its help.

Its main advantage is independent work, during which you do not need to participate and make efforts. In addition, a big plus of stationary blenders is the power, which will be greater than that of immersion models.

Stationary blender

Such models are cheaper, and in most of them there is a self-cleaning function. This is a big plus, as the hostess will not be afraid to cut herself with knives while washing the unit.

Stationary models also have disadvantages. Since the unit is designed to handle large volumes, then it takes up a lot of space in the kitchen. If you process small portions of food in it, then the knife will most likely not be able to touch the entire portion. Products simply remain smeared on the wall.

A stationary blender can do the following:

  • whip cream or proteins;
  • grind meat, cheese, fruits, vegetables or ice;
  • make cream soup, smoothies or smoothies.

Bowl selection

Description of types of blender bowls
Each tank will have its own advantages and disadvantages. If earlier a device with a plastic container was cheaper than a glass one, now the situation has changed a bit.

Proven manufacturers produce good-quality plastic containers that do not darken over time and do not absorb a bad smell. A unit with such a capacity will be expensive.

If you have made your choice in favor of a stationary device and want to buy this particular type, you need to pay attention to the material of the bowl.

  • The glass container will not absorb odors, will not darken over time. You can lay hot products in it.
  • Plastic capacity will be much easier, it will not break. But over time, scratches may appear on it, it may darken.

The glass container looks prettier, moreover, it is environmentally friendly. But if you break it, it will be difficult to find exactly the same.

No less important indicator is the volume of the bowl. If a blender is purchased for home use, the volume of the bowl should be 1.5–2 liters. Each manufacturer produces devices with such a bowl volume - choosing is not a problem.

Hand blender 

Design, pros and cons of a hand blender
This unit has a completely different design. It has an oblong shape, on one side of which a rotating knife is installed, and on the other hand, a motor is located serving as a handle.

The housing may be metal or plastic. The plastic case is easy to clean, does not burden the design. In addition, on sale it can be in different colors.

Hand blender - which is better to choose? Models that are more expensive can have a steel or aluminum case. Distinguish between glossy and matte surfaces. Experts recommend stopping your choice on a matte surface, as fingerprints and stains from products will always remain on the glossy surface.

Some models are equipped with a container, which provides for whipping products. If you bought a blender without a container, any other convenient and deep bowl or pan can replace it.

The submersible model is designed to grind or whisk a small portion of products. It is characterized by multifunctionality, compactness and mobility. It can independently in the process of work change the position of the knife, which cannot be said about the stationary model.

The power of such a technique may be different, but it will be less than that of a stationary device. This is a significant minus. In any case, when buying a manual unit, choose a power of at least 300 watts. The more powerful the appliance, the faster it grinds food and meat.

To cook food and cocktails at home, you need a device that will have 5-7 speeds. The number of speeds will directly depend on the power of the device. A blender with a small power has 1-2 speeds, and in powerful units there can be up to 15. For example, to make meat from meat, a sufficiently low speed. If you do the work at high speed, instead of stuffing, you may get pasta.

Options and functions of the submersible model

Description of functions and configuration of submersible blenders
There are modes: impulse, smooth adjustment, turbo mode. An expensive device of a well-known company will have not only high power, but also many speeds. Decide whether to overpay for features that you simply won’t use.

The disadvantage of this model can only be that every time after use it must be hidden in a box and removed from the table. And if you take a small container, the whipping of different products and meat will be accompanied by spray flying in all directions. This must be taken into account when choosing the right capacity for the job.

If you need to use the device for a long time, it will be difficult, since it must always be held in your hands. The length of the power cord is also important. The device will be extremely inconvenient to work if the cord length is less than 1 meter.

Depending on the manufacturer and the price of the apparatus, a different number of nozzles and containers will be attached to the blender. The most popular are the following:

  1. Measuring cup - in the kitchen it will be simply irreplaceable even as an independent container. If it is made of plastic, it will not break in the near future.
  2. Chopper - a standard nozzle in the form of knives, with which products are crushed. It is a container with a lid, at the bottom of which knives are installed. The usual material from which it is made is plastic, but metal is also found. Some grinders in the lid have holes in which you can add or add ingredients without turning off the appliance.
  3. Whisk - thanks to this nozzle, the old mixer can be presented to someone. Suitable for whipping batter, cream and eggs. With it you can cook a wonderful pancake dough.
  4. Mill - with its help you can effectively grind the smallest portions.
  5. Vacuum pump - with its help you can pump air out of a special container, create a vacuum. So the food will be stored much longer.
  6. Shredder - nozzle designed for slicing vegetables and fruits, as well as some varieties of cheese.

The product is intended for cooking:

  • cream soup;
  • mousse;
  • milk or fruit cocktail;
  • breadcrumbs;
  • minced meat;
  • whipped cream.

Useful tips from specialists

Recommendations of specialists for choosing a blender for home
If you decide to buy a blender, first take an inventory in your kitchen. If you have a mixer, you do not need a whisk nozzle. When there is a coffee grinder, you do not need a mill nozzle.

And if you have been baking bread in a bread machine for a long time, you do not need a nozzle for making dough at all.

When choosing a machine, pay attention to the fact that the knife mount must be on a high-strength plate. This will allow you to use the device for a long time, despite high loads.

A stationary device during operation can vibrate violently, which over time begins to annoy. To avoid this, you need to choose the right unit on suction cups or on rubber legs.

Powerful aggregates can grind both soft and hard products. If the complete set of two blenders is the same, and the power is different, the more powerful model will be more expensive.

Experts recommend choosing a stationary blender model for large families and for production purposes. And if you use it at home and not really load it, the model of the submersible unit is suitable.

Before buying any equipment, carefully read reviews about it. If the store did not have your chosen model, do not be upset. You need to pay attention, remember, and better write down the names of the blender models recommended by the consultant. At home on the Internet to read all the advantages and disadvantages of the proposed models, and only then make your choice.

Experts advise for a small family to buy a submersible assembly. In addition, in a small kitchen he will be a great helper.
